1985 Swift DB-1 / Honda
VIN: 072-85
History, Features, Specs and Options
From the seller:
"I’ve often been told by long-time FF drivers that they miss their Swift DB-1. It is a great, forgiving, fun and fast racer, especially with the Honda Swift engine. This Swift has evolved at the hands of its devoted owners, including top National competitors, over its lifetime. It is comprised of the best components available at the time and has been meticulously maintained.
This car has 7 Runoff Appearances (Kolthoff (5), Forrer, Palacio), and has been driven gently by me since 2008. The previous owner and I have run primarily Mid-Atlantic and Right Coast series races. All SCCA log books exist."
